Russia’s first player, Daniil Medvedev, reached the semi-finals of the ATP 500 tennis tournament held in Dubai.

In the quarter-final match of the final, the Russian defeated Alejandro Davidovich-Fokina. The match, which lasted 1 hour and 18 minutes, ended with scores of 6:2 and 6:3.

Medvedev will compete with the winner of the match between Pole Hubert Hurkacz and French Hugo Humbert to reach the final.

On February 29, another Russian, Andrey Rublev, played his quarter-final match. He turned out to be stronger than Sebastian Korda. In the second set of the match, the American player refused to continue the fight. In the semi-finals, Rublev will face Alexander Bublik from Kazakhstan.

The prize money for the tournament in the UAE exceeds $2.9 million. The competition will end on March 2. The current champion is Medvedev, who beat Rublev in the final.

Russian tennis players compete as neutral athletes in international tournaments. By the decision of Great Britain, they missed the Wimbledon tournament, the only Grand Slam tournament in 2022.
